In a Blue Haze: Smoking and Bahá’í Ethics by Udo Schaefer discusses the medical and socio-political aspects of smoking. These issues have long been under discussion, yet the ethical issues involved have hitherto been ignored. Nevertheless, the theme of smoking is secondary in this book. Tobacco consumption is used to illustrate and delineate the contours of Bahá’í ethics, as religious ethics which has only very recently become the subject of academic analysis.
